Trek Route and Highlights

The trek route is a key determinant of the duration. A detailed map is crucial, highlighting the key milestones and attractions along the way. Understanding the route ensures a smoother and more organized trekking experience.

The Brahmatal trek presents a diverse range of landscapes, from dense forests and pristine lakes to snow-covered meadows. Trekkers will find themselves amidst nature’s wonders, passing by enchanting landmarks like Bekaltal, Brahmatal Lake, and the awe-inspiring views of Mt. Trishul.

Altitude and Its Effects

Given the altitude of the Brahmatal trek, it’s crucial to be aware of altitude sickness and its effects on the body. Taking measures to acclimatize properly and recognizing symptoms early on is vital for a safe journey.

As trekkers ascend to higher altitudes, the air becomes thinner, and the body needs time to adjust. Trekkers who ascend too quickly may experience common symptoms like headaches, nausea, and exhaustion. Therefore, allowing sufficient time for acclimatization and staying hydrated are essential precautions.

Wildlife Encounters

The Brahmatal trek offers encounters with diverse wildlife. Being aware of the local fauna and taking necessary precautions ensures both safety and a deeper connection with nature.

The region is home to various species, including Himalayan Monals, musk deer, and occasionally, the elusive snow leopard. Trekkers may catch a glimpse of these fascinating creatures in their natural habitat, enhancing the overall wilderness experience.
